Lemon Curd Tart

  • Total Time: 55 minutes
  • Yield: 8 servings 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

A delightful dessert that perfectly balances tartness and sweetness, featuring a creamy lemon filling atop a buttery crust.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up powdered sugar
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/2 cup fresh lemon juice
  • 1 tablespoon lemon zest
  • 1/4 teaspoon baking powder

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Combine the flour, powdered sugar, and salt in a mixing bowl. Cut in the softened butter until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s.
  3. Press the crumbly mixture into the bottom of a tart pan to form the crust.
  4. Bake the crust in the preheated oven for about 20 minutes or until it is lightly golden.
  5. Whisk together the eggs, granulated sugar, lemon juice, lemon zest, and baking powder in a separate bowl until smooth.
  6. Pour the lemon filling into the baked crust, spreading it evenly.
  7. Return it to the oven and bake for an additional 20-25 minutes or until the filling is set and slightly puffed.
  8. Let the tart cool completely before slicing and serving. Enjoy your delicious fresh lemon dessert!

Notes

Chill before serving for a refreshing bite. Top with lemon slices or fresh berries for enhanced presentation.
